STUDENT INTRO TO THE OPERATING ROOM (OR)

 

UNIVERSITY of UTAH

Eccles Health Sciences Library-Garden Level

Friday, May 19, 2017

6pm-8pm

 

The Student Intro to the OR Course is designed to give a 'behind the scenes' look at the OR and the exciting career and educational opportunities that exist behind the red line. 

We provide students with the essential basic knowledge needed to safely enter, navigate, observe and participate in the OR. Our goal is to increase interest in this fascinating, rarely visited area, and inform students about options for shadowing or working in the OR someday. 

During this 2 hour course, we discuss career options in the OR, proper dress, basic OR etiquette, OR safety, roles of individuals in the OR, and where/how to stand using the ACS/ASE Medical Student Simulation-Based Surgical Skills Curriculum.

Learners will have the opportunity to participate in a simulated experience of scrubbing, gowning, gloving, and removing their ‘dirty’ gown.

COURSE OBJECTIVES:

Upon completion of this course, students will be able to:

  • Identify the role of observer vs. participant in the OR

  • Verbalize different career options for working in the OR 

  • Review basic safety rules of the OR

  • Discuss the roles and relationships of each individual in the room

  • Define the boundaries of a sterile field

  • Demonstrate proper method of scrubbing, being gowned and gloved
